Hospitality Design Studio | INDE 212 | 2020
Student's endeavored to design a bistro located within a theoretical hotel representative of a historical/cultural aspect of the City of Rochester. Working with a local hotel group they developed an understanding of hotel standards as they would be applied within this site in downtown Rochester. This studio was impacted by the rapid shift to online instruction due to NYS COVID-19 isolation requirements. Projects were abbreviated but the outcomes represent the sprit and creativity which exemplifies RIT Interior Design! Students were challenged with adapting to issues with hardware and often unstable internet connectivity in their homes.
